What to check before for buildings with laundry rooms near the 4 train in Manhattan
- Search results combine two filters: near the 4 train and with laundry. Use the map and address-level details to confirm your walk time.
- Before signing, confirm what “laundry” means in that building (in-unit machines, shared laundry room, or both) and whether any floors have access limits.
- Check operational details: washer/dryer availability, typical wait time, payment method (coin/card), and maintenance history mentioned in tenant Q&A.
- Look for the lease terms tied to laundry access, including any rules about damage, overuse, or scheduling for shared rooms.
- Verify the full move-in cost during showings and document walkthroughs, since laundry can affect deposit or utility expectations in some buildings (ask what’s included).
